Dining in a darkly-lit room can create an air of mystery, a romantic mood, and the perfect occasion for wearing glow-in-the-dark gloves to dinner. Dim sum with today’s Groupon: £17 for a 16-piece dim sum platter for two with a cocktail each at The Gate.

A dumpling roll away from Notting Hill Gate underground station, The Gate supplies West London with a chic setting for Asian dining and cocktails galore. The bar and restaurant harbours cosy corners, comfy sofas, and candlelight for private dinner dates, a lengthy drinks menu bursting with wines to compliment the nibbles, and cocktails and bubbly for special occasions. With a themed club night six days a week ranging from salsa to classic floor fillers, diners can nibble on light bites, main meals, or swanky canapés before getting their after dinner groove on.
In a relaxed evening or to kick-off the night out, hungry double acts can settle in to a the premium 'Love Sum' platter featuring a 16 piece line-up of prawn dim sum, duck gyoza, scallop dumplings, and spinach and crab, all served either crispy or steamed and with a selection of dips. The feast is cunningly accompanied by a cocktail each from a menu set to burst with cosmopolitans, mojitos, and lychee martinis, making for a sophisticated dining experience.
